Is Bloodsport Worth Watching? Honest Movie Review & Audience Verdict (2025)

After a protest gets out of control, activists Nell and Esme are forced to go on the run. They squat in a beautiful and seemingly empty mansion, but danger descends when another interloper arrives with an unexpected connection to Esme.
